Introduction

Lab.gruppen IPX Series amplifiers provide exceptionally high power density 

and powerful integrated DSP features, making them suitable for a broad range 

of installed and touring sound applications. All IPX Series amplifiers feature 

both analog and AES3 inputs with link outputs; input mixing; comprehensive 

DSP functions (crossover, parametric EQ, delay and limiter control); network 

control via Ethernet on shielded  Cat-5 cable or using suitable WiFi access point; 

IPX Controller software and iPad native app; comprehensive front-panel display 

and dedicated mute buttons; and both binding post and Neutrik speakON 

output connectors.
The information contained in this Quick Start Guide is sufficient for proper 

installation of IPX Series amplifiers, and for configuration of settings in typical 

applications. 
Except as specifically noted, all features, values and connections are identical for 

all models.

Unpacking and visual checks

Every Lab.gruppen amplifier is carefully tested and inspected before leaving the 

factory and should arrive in perfect condition. If any damage is discovered, please 

notify the shipping carrier immediately.
Save the packing materials for the carrier’s inspection and for any 

future shipping. 

Installation

IPX 1200

 – Depth is 336 mm (13.2") rack ear to back panel. Weight is 

approximately 5.3 kg (11.7 lbs). Rear support brackets are included and use is 

recommended in all applications.

IPX 2400

 – Depth is 423 mm (16.7") rack ear to back panel. Weight is 

approximately 7 kg (15.4 lbs). Rear support brackets are included and use is 

recommended in all applications.

IPX 4800

 – Depth is 472 mm (18.6") rack ear to back panel. Weight is 

approximately 8.5 kg (18.7 lbs). Rear support brackets are included and use is 

recommended in all applications.   

Cooling

Please ensure that there is sufficient space in the front and the rear of each 

amplifier to allow for a free flow of air. No doors or covers should be mounted 

either in the front or rear of the amplifiers. Amplifiers may be stacked directly 

on top of each other with no spacing, though some spacing may enable more 

convenient installation of rear cabling.

Operating voltage

All IPX Series amplifiers have a universal power supply that operates on mains 

from 100 – 240 V at 50 or 60 Hz. The IEC receptacle on the rear panel accepts the 

supplied IEC cord which terminates in a connector appropriate for the country 

of sale. When AC power is connected, the amplifier goes into standby (red 

indication on standby LED). The amplifier may be turned on by pressing the front 

power button or remotely using the IPX Controller software. 

Grounding

Signal ground is floating via a resistor to chassis, and therefore grounding is 

automatic. For safety reasons, never disconnect the earth (ground) pin on the AC 

power cord. Use balanced input connections to avoid hum and interference

The following indicators and controls are available on the  

front panel:

(1) 

MENU

 – Selects MENU mode and confirms a given  

preset name.

(2) 

BACK

 – Moves backward through menu layers in  

MENU mode.

(3) 

MUTE

 – Mutes corresponding channel as indicated.

(4) 

SIG

 – Illuminates green when signal is present. Illuminates red when 

signal is clipping (pre input mixer)

(5) 

POWER

 – Indicates STANDBY (red)

(6) 

LIM

 (limit) – Illuminates when the amplifier limits  

the signal.
Limiting is engaged when the channel:

•  Reaches the selected voltage limit
•  Mains voltage cannot maintain full rail voltage

(7) 

ADJUST/SET 

(Rotary Encoder) – Rotation moves through the menu and 

adjusts the currently selected parameter when in setup mode. Pressing 

down on the knob selects a given parameter or advances further into the 

menu.
In operating mode, rotation of the ADJUST/SET encoder adjusts output gain 

(outputs ganged).

(8) 

BACKLIT DISPLAY

In operating mode, the display shows the following values and status 

indicators:

•  Level – Horizontal VU meters for each channel
•  Device name and Preset name

In setup mode, the display shows currently selected menu locations 

and parameters.

Rear Panel

The following connectors are available on the rear panel:

(9) 

ANALOG INPUTS and LINK

 – female XLR input connectors provided for 

each channel, with male XLR link output connectors.

(10) 

AES3 INPUT and LINK

 – AES3 digital inputs are on a female XLR 

connector with a link output on a male XLR connector.

(11) 

NETWORK (Ethernet)

 – An RJ45 jack is supplied for connection to an 

Ethernet network for external control and monitoring, either by a direct 

wired connection or via an external WiFi router to an iPad or tablet. 

LEDs below the connector indicate valid network connection (LINK) and 

network activity (ACT).

(12) 

speakON OUTPUT CONNECTORS

 – Both channel outputs are available  

on a four-pole connector at the left; either channel 1 or both channels  

1 and 2 may be connected. Only channel 2 is available on the connector  

to the right.

(13) 

BINDING POST CONNECTORS

 – Connectors for channel 1 and channel 2.

(14) 

AC LINE INPUT

 – A locking IEC receptacle accepts the AC line input, 

50 Hz or 60 Hz, 100 V – 240 V. Use an IEC cable with the proper connector 

for country of use.
